How much does a Provider Network Manager make in Denver, CO? The average Provider Network Manager salary in Denver, CO is $112,798 as of March 26, 2024, but the range typically falls between $101,698 and $123,381.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on many important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, the number of years you have spent in your profession. Percentile | Salary | Location | Last Updated |
10th Percentile Provider Network Manager Salary | $91,593 | Denver,CO | March 26, 2024 |
25th Percentile Provider Network Manager Salary | $101,698 | Denver,CO | March 26, 2024 |
50th Percentile Provider Network Manager Salary | $112,798 | Denver,CO | March 26, 2024 |
75th Percentile Provider Network Manager Salary | $123,381 | Denver,CO | March 26, 2024 |
90th Percentile Provider Network Manager Salary | $133,017 | Denver,CO | March 26, 2024 |

Provider Network Manager manages the operations of a healthcare provider network. Responsible for establishing and maintaining processes and systems to provide routine services to members including contract management and credentialing. Being a Provider Network Manager recruits, hires, trains, and measures performance of staff to provide effective and operations within budget. May be involved with the design and operations of database systems used to manage provider data and produce reports and analysis. Additionally, Provider Network Manager requ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to top management. The Provider Network Manager typically manages through subordinate managers and professionals in larger groups of moderate complexity. Provides input to strategic decisions that affect the functional area of responsibility. May give input into developing the budget. Capable of resolving escalated issues arising from operations and requiring coordination with other departments. To be a Provider Network Manager typically requires 3+ years of managerial experience. Provider Network Manager salary varies from city to city. Compared with national average salary of Provider Network Manager, the highest Provider Network Manager salary is in San Francisco, CA, where the Provider Network Manager salary is 25.0% above. The lowest Provider Network Manager salary is in Miami, FL, where the Provider Network Manager salary is 3.5% lower than national average salary.
